#pragma once
#include "ASTScopedVisitor.h"
#include "ContextProviderInlines.h"
namespace WGSL::AST {
template<typename T>
void ScopedVisitor<T>::visit(Function& function)
{
ContextScope functionScope(this);
Visitor::visit(function);
}
template<typename T>
void ScopedVisitor<T>::visit(CompoundStatement& statement)
{
ContextScope blockScope(this);
Visitor::visit(statement);
}
template<typename T>
void ScopedVisitor<T>::visit(ForStatement& statement)
{
ContextScope forScope(this);
Visitor::visit(statement);
}
template<typename T>
void ScopedVisitor<T>::visit(LoopStatement& loopStatement)
{
ContextScope loopScope(this);
for (auto& attribute : loopStatement.attributes())
checkErrorAndVisit(attribute);
for (auto& statement : loopStatement.body())
checkErrorAndVisit(statement);
if (auto& continuing = loopStatement.continuing()) {
ContextScope continuingScope(this);
checkErrorAndVisit(*continuing);
}
}
} // namespace WGSL::AST
